Table 2C: Expanded Eviction Prevention Witryna24 lip 2024 · Landlords can proceed with eviction filings in cases where tenants owe at least $600 and the landlord has applied for rent relief funds from D.C.’s STAY program. This provision means either the landlord applied for aid but the tenant failed to provide the required information, or the relief funds did not cover the full overdue balance. notting hill nursing home west bloomfield

Latin imminent is a … WitrynaEminent domain refers to the power of the government to take private property and convert it into public use, referred to as a taking. The Fifth Amendment provides that the government may only exercise this power if they provide just compensation to the property owners. A taking may be the actual seizure of property by the government, or …
